Coach will not start

can not get coach to start. checked battery's and cleaned posts put charger on and found they are up. every things work . when turning key only get a clicking and motor will not turn over . any ideas

Unfortunately you have not given much info to go on re type coach, gas-diesel, year, etc.

However, you stated that "everything works". Not really sure what that means. But, usually, when everything works as normal....lights, radio, fans, etc....but the starter motor only clicks, a common problem is a ground issue at the battery or a loose connection at the solenoid/starter motor. Starter motors draw SERIOUS amperage, especially on diesels. Bad grounds and/or loose connections will easily give the characteristics you describe. Those are easy places to check and good places to start.

You may want to provide additional coach info so that others that have experienced this can provide more helpful suggestions.

Agree, it could be a ground issue or the starter/starter solenoid but if starter solenoid is "clicking" it could be that your bats are showing 12v during charge but nolonger carrying/producing amps during discharge/load. How old are you bats? What does the volt gauge show when the starter clicks? Have you used the battery boost button [if you have one] to tie house and chassis bats together during starting? If no boost button--think I'd try jumping or boosting the chassis bats with a charger but if the bats are bad, it may not work. Have you checked the chassis disconnect switch in the rear bay or the ground fuse? Helps if you have a second person to turn the ignition switch while you check the voltages.

It sounds like you have a bad starter solenoid. Freight liner has a new starter for the Cummins engine. I had the same problem, installed the replacement starter and all has been fine since. I saved the old starter to get it rebuilt so I have a spare.
